Top 5 Best Lowndes County Public Elementary Schools (2024)

For the 2024 school year, there are 6 public elementary schools serving 818 students in Lowndes County, AL.
The top ranked public elementary schools in Lowndes County, AL are Hayneville Middle School, Jacksonsteele Elementary School and Lowndes County Middle School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Lowndes County, AL public elementary schools have an average math proficiency score of 5% (versus the Alabama public elementary school average of 22%), and reading proficiency score of 16% (versus the 47% statewide average). Elementary schools in Lowndes County have an average ranking of 1/10, which is in the bottom 50% of Alabama public elementary schools.
Minority enrollment is 98% of the student body (majority Black), which is more than the Alabama public elementary school average of 47% (majority Black).
